Hamburg Sea Devils Sign Taulia Tagovailoa to Replace Injured Quarterback

The younger brother of NFL star Tua Tagovailoa joins the ELF team, with his debut set for May 31 against the Stuttgart Surge.

Overview

  • The Hamburg Sea Devils have officially signed Taulia Tagovailoa to fill the quarterback role left vacant by Micah Leon's hand injury.
  • Tagovailoa, formerly of the CFL's Hamilton Tiger-Cats, brings experience from both Canadian professional football and a standout college career.
  • The 25-year-old played one season at the University of Alabama and set multiple records during his four years at the University of Maryland.
  • ELF Commissioner Patrick Esume praised the signing as a milestone for the league's growing international profile and competitiveness.
  • Tagovailoa is scheduled to make his debut on May 31 at Bremen's Weserstadion, where the Sea Devils will face the Stuttgart Surge.
